The Athlete's Foot


No...not the fungus or tinea infested foot, I am talking about The Athlete's Foot shoes company in general. My pair of New Balance runners were long overdue for replacement, so I took advantage of the new year sale and got myself a new pairs at The Athlete's Foot in Belmont. I have never shopped in any of the stores before and to my surprise, it was a truly enjoyable experience indeed. Not only they measured and recommended a pair perfect fitting shoes, the girl that was servicing us even told me I am an "overpronator" and required shoes that minimize pronation on the medial side of my feet. She recommended a pair of Wave Nirvana 6 by Mizuno, which is a superseded model and that meant good bargain. Jin got a pair new Nike runners too at the same time. We were there for more than 40mins from start to finish and not at any stage that we felt rushed by the girl, even though half of that time was passed their normal store closing time! Being in retail for a fair while myself, I know how annoying it is for customers to come in just before closing time, but to The Athelete's Foot, this is obviously not the case. That's what I call service! We know where we will go next time when we need new sport shoes, do you? :)
